Hudson's Story

Meet Hudson — a 3-month-old German Shepherd mix with movie-star looks, effortless charm, and the kind of smooth personality that makes everyone fall for him instantly. <br/><br/>This handsome little guy has a warm, friendly nature and carries himself like he already knows he’s the total package. Cool, confident, and irresistibly sweet, Hudson is ready to win hearts wherever he goes.<br/><br/>• Warm, friendly, and naturally charming<br/>• Good with other dogs and enjoys easygoing companionship<br/>• Cats and kids unknown — slow, thoughtful introductions recommended<br/>• Playful, curious, and always looking good doing it<br/>• Smart, handsome, and growing into one loyal best friend<br/><br/>Hudson is the perfect mix of sweet puppy energy and smooth gentleman vibes. With love, guidance, and plenty of adventures, this dashing boy is ready to become someone’s forever sidekick.

Northwest Working Breed Rescue's Adoption Policy
Northwest Working Breed Rescue uses an application-based adoption process that includes screening, reference checks, and adopter conversations to ensure appropriate placement. All dogs receive required veterinary care prior to adoption, with spay/neuter completed or contractually required. The rescue prioritizes responsible matches and provides post-adoption support.

Our Mission
Northwest Working Breed Rescue is organized exclusively for charitable purposes to rescue, care for, rehabilitate, and rehome working-breed dogs. The organization provides foster-based care, veterinary treatment, behavioral support, and public education to promote humane treatment and responsible ownership.
